My ads look wrong. Whats up with them?
You have to make sure you get the right ad format from your Google Adsense code for the area where your ads are being displayed. For example, if you are putting an ad in a sidebar widget, you’re probably best with a tall skyscraper advert rather than a 600 pixel wide image ad. Try a few out to see what looks best. Don’t forget to take into account the colour or the shape of the corners of the advert to keep it in theme with your page style.
